Output 7302e633380524d27ecdf129c89e01b783b68861da12db2189f75939157515e7:0

value
34741
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f7b641d5ed8d5443e49a3b6d28b3cb668b44909 OP_EQUAL
address
3BrUkCVftAvDw4fthSXrN5WSQcLgA9DTUu
transaction
7302e633380524d27ecdf129c89e01b783b68861da12db2189f75939157515e7
spent
true